In the face of evolving legal landscapes, ⁣gold ‌dealers must adopt a proactive approach⁤ to compliance and risk management. This entails staying abreast of ‍local, national, ⁢and⁤ international regulations‍ that ‍govern the buying and ⁤selling of precious metals. ⁢One effective strategy is to establish ‍robust internal compliance⁢ programs that⁣ include regular training for ‌staff on legal obligations and ethical practices. By fostering ‍a culture of compliance, dealers can ⁤mitigate the risk of legal disputes and enhance their reputation in the industry.⁢ Additionally,conducting thorough due diligence on suppliers ‍and customers to verify their legitimacy can ⁤prevent ‌associations⁢ with illegal activities.

moreover, gold ⁢dealers should consider⁤ forming strategic ​partnerships with legal ⁤experts specializing in commodities ​law and⁣ regulatory issues. This collaboration​ can provide invaluable insights into navigating complex legal challenges ‍efficiently. Implementing a risk assessment ‌framework ⁣ that includes ⁢continuous monitoring of ⁤regulatory changes will allow dealers to adjust their⁢ operations swiftly. Essential best practices include:

  • Documenting​ Transactions: Maintain⁣ clear⁢ records of all transactions to ⁤demonstrate compliance.
  • Engaging in Transparency: Be open about sourcing and​ pricing ​to build trust with customers and regulators.
  • utilizing Technology: Leverage software ⁤solutions for tracking compliance⁣ and reporting obligations.
